GREEN x EXPO 2027 A symposium was held two years ago.

                                                                                                            
                                                                                                               
GREEN × EXPO 2027 welcomes you with overwhelming flowers and greenery, and focuses on climate change, which has a significant impact on our lives, and works with citizens in harmony with the environment. This is the first international exposition in Japan with the theme of "Kingkyo".

A symposium was held two years before the event (March 19).

At the symposium, participants discussed the role of GREEN × EXPO in addressing global issues such as climate change, and measures to coexist with the environment and sustain nature, people and society together.

Speaker Profile (title omitted, no particular order)

                                                                                                                                   
                                                                                                                                                                                                                       
Mari Yoshitaka

Director of the International Horticultural Expo Association 2027/Fellow of Mitsubishi UFJ Research & Consulting Co., Ltd. (Sustainability)
Professor, Faculty of Liberal Arts, The University of Tokyo. Professor, Keio University. Graduate School of Environment and Sustainability, University of Michigan, USA. Graduate School of Media and Governance, Keio University. He has been engaged in environmental finance consulting for many years. Joined Mitsubishi UFJ Research & Consulting in May 2020. Currently, he provides advice and advice on climate change, GX, sustainable finance, etc. to various sectors. Member of the 2027 International Horticultural Expo Association Sustainability Expert Committee.

                                                                                                                                   
                                                                                                                                                                                                                       
Hijioka Yasuaki (Yasuaki)

Director, Center for Climate Change Adaptation Center, National Institute for Environmental Studies. Born in Kagoshima Prefecture in 1971. Graduated from the Graduate School of Engineering, the University of Tokyo in 2001. Ph.D. He joined the National Institute for Environmental Studies in the same year. Current position since 2023. His expertise is the impact and adaptation of climate change. He has authored "ADAPTATION 100 strategies to survive the climate crisis." IPCC WGII AR5 CLA (General Author) and LA (Representative Author) of the 1.5°C Special Report.

                                                                                                                                   
                                                                                                                                                                                                                       
Sato Rumi (Rumi)

Executive Director, NPO Bir. She presides over the “Midori Intermediate Support Organization” that draws out the power of the city’s “green” and utilizes it in community development. Created partnerships between industry, government, academia and citizens in various places based on park green spaces. Member of the Green Infrastructure Public-Private Partnership Platform Steering Committee.

                                                                                                                                   
                                                                                                                                                                                                                       
Yasuyuki Igarashi (Yasuyuki)

Director of Zero Carbon and GREEN×EXPO Promotion Bureau, Yokohama City. In the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ism and Fukui Prefecture, he was involved in urban planning and community development, operation of state-owned Hitachi Seaside Park and Showa Memorial Park, Expo of Osaka Hana, etc., and worked as Minister's Secretariat of the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ism before assuming his current position in 2023.
